Spanish Activist Felipa Velazquez Supports Morocco's Territorial Integrity

Spanish activist Felipa Velazquez, previously a vocal supporter of the Polisario Front, has publicly shifted her position to endorse Spanish Prime Minister Pedro Sánchez's support for Morocco's territorial integrity regarding Western Sahara. The announcement was made on July 28, 2026, according to verified reports.

Velazquez stated that she now recognizes the Moroccan autonomy plan as a viable solution for the Western Sahara dispute, aligning with Sánchez's 2022 decision to back Morocco's stance. This marks a significant reversal from her earlier advocacy for Sahrawi independence.

The activist's change of heart comes amid ongoing diplomatic efforts between Spain and Morocco, which have strengthened since Sánchez's visit to Rabat in April 2022. The Spanish government has consistently emphasized the autonomy plan as the most realistic basis for resolving the conflict.

No further details about Velazquez's motivations or any specific events leading to her decision were available from verified sources at the time of reporting.
